Output eb7895f7ea3699eba461d5baf7b0054e65c75ea592d5eb18904f6cc20da8f2de:20

value
1104635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f8efa6b10de53fc5635e4afe1c9607560f8eaa OP_EQUAL
address
39oTboz2rTkyCGWUBxtSuJGkwgaZehEzV7
transaction
eb7895f7ea3699eba461d5baf7b0054e65c75ea592d5eb18904f6cc20da8f2de